C. Lane Morgan, 82, husband of Kathryn B. Morgan, of Seneca, passed away Saturday, March 9, 2024, at his home.
C. Lane Morgan was born in Seneca, SC on December 11, 1941, the twelfth of twelve children of the late Dewitt O. and Grace C. Morgan. He graduated from Oakway High Scholl in 1960. He was an avid sports enthusiast participating in football, baseball, softball and basketball (team captain). He loved his dear Clemson Tigers. He earned his private pilot's license early in life and enjoyed flying very much.
In 1968, Lane opened Morgan Insurance Agency in Seneca and it was there he spent a long career in risk management, life and benefits business. Through the years, he completed many educational courses in an effort to always be the best professional he could be. He sold his business in 2016 and fully retired in 2017. During his insurance career, he served as president of the Oconee Independent Insurance Agents and was a member of the Independent Insurance Agents of South Carolina. He was listed in "Who's Who in American Business and Professionals." He was a recipient of the Ballenger Award, presented by the Seneca Rotary Club, recognizing distinguished business persons.
Before becoming a member of Seneca Baptist Church, he was instrumental in the founding of Grace Baptist Church in Seneca, where he served as Trustee and Sunday School Teacher for many years.
In addition to his wife, Lane is survived by his son: Bradley Brown Morgan (Denise) of Big Canoe, GA; grandchild: one very special granddaughter that was his heartstrings, Sally Caroline Morgan of Louisville, KY; brother: J. Leon Morgan of Seneca, SC; sister: Barbara S. DeFoor of Seneca, SC; sister-in-law: Dorothy Morgan of Millington, TN; numerous nieces and nephews and other family whom he also loved.
In addition to his parents, Lane was preceded in death by his brothers: Woodfin, James, Wallace, Rayford, Major J. and Jesse C. Morgan; and sisters: Margaret M. Carnes, Shirley M. Davis and Patricia Morgan.
